Output 6f905910f1203d39bd15d2e4cc8f392df0a499c05a75efc8d02aa77aeb950c65:3

value
790460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cc15e936c5d99666f93828f5e123ebb137c017f OP_EQUALVERIFY OP_CHECKSIG
address
13d3Zv5zEUDZzBhJsBy5XvyYauKsKrp6Lz
transaction
6f905910f1203d39bd15d2e4cc8f392df0a499c05a75efc8d02aa77aeb950c65
confirmations
318326
spent
true